1. Our species is influenced by our surroundings, genetics, and culture.


When British artist Neil Harbisson was born, he could only see grayscale. Neil was diagnosed with achromatopsia, a hereditary disease that impairs the eye's natural capacity to see color. But then something changed. Harbisson can detect more colors than any human in the world.


In 2004, Harbisson had a unique antenna inserted in his skull. This incredible technology recognizes colors and sends them directly to Harbisson's brain as musical notes. With this technology, he can "hear" a wider variety of colors than the human eye.


Harbisson's skill resembles science fiction. However, tools have always helped humanity. We have thrived because of our culture's ability to complement our biology.


The main point here is that our species is influenced by our environment, genetics, and culture. 


Humans are unquestionably one of the most successful species on Earth. Today, billions of people live on all seven continents. Many of us live long, healthy lives, and our diverse, interconnected society creates everything from moving art to vast infrastructure. 


So, how did humanity arrive here while other creatures stayed in their natural habitats? Our incredible rise as a species is attributable to the evolutionary triad. This triad comprises three components: our environment, genetics, and culture. The complicated interplay between these aspects has enabled our species to modify itself and the Earth. 


We, like all other species, evolved in nature. The Earth's geological and ecological systems were the foundation for our existence. Then, via natural selection, our species gained unique features to help it navigate its surroundings. These characteristics include bipedalism (walking on two feet) and complex vocal cords for speaking. Finally, we strengthen these characteristics with culture, the accumulated information we pass down through generations.


Throughout the millennia, human culture has produced many advancements. Only four stand out as absolutely extraordinary. First, there's fire, which gives us more energy than our bodies can. The second is language, which allows us to store and transfer information. The third aspect is beauty, which gives our life meaning and structure. Finally, time will enable us to observe our surroundings objectively and rationally.

2. Fire helped humans become more intelligent, social, and robust.


On their own, ngardu seeds could be more appealing. In fact, if improperly prepared, this Australian plant can be highly toxic. However, the Yandruwandha people live in the bush and eat them regularly.


This aboriginal clan understands the proper method for grinding, straining, and, most importantly, cooking these seeds into nourishing bread. Their intricate strategy was refined over generations, allowing them to flourish in conditions that would typically be too harsh for humans.


Culinary traditions like Yandruwandha's exist all across the world. And, by letting us grow food in even the most desert environments, they have helped us spread far and wide. However diverse these traditions may be, they all share one common element: fire.


The main takeaway is that fire helped humans become more intelligent, more social, and more powerful.


It's difficult to overestimate the significance of fire in human history. It's no accident that numerous societies, from ancient Greece to Nigeria's Ekoi people, have tales about gods being the originators of fire. Modern scientists, however, tell a different picture. They think our human ancestors started building fires in East Africa's Rift Valley around 1.5 million years ago.


For various reasons, mankind was transformed by the ability to harness fire. For starters, it allowed us to cook both meat and vegetables. This simple process increases the nutritional value of food and makes it easier to digest. Cooked beef, for example, provides 40% more calories than its raw counterpart. All those extra calories helped our brains grow more extensive, allowing our bodies to devote less energy to our stomachs and more to cognitive functioning.


The physical benefits of fire were complemented by its social benefits. Building and keeping flames is challenging. Therefore, people had to use their larger brains to create gadgets to keep their hearths blazing. And, of course, continuing to reinvent the wheel is costly. As a result, humans had to develop the social skills required to impart and transmit this knowledge. Those tribes that excelled in communicating and improving these strategies went on to expand and spread into other territories.


As mankind's knowledge expanded, so did its technological advancements. As a result, these technologies might sustain more extensive and sophisticated communities. Humans learned to employ fire to convert mud into pottery after they harnessed it. They then utilized the pottery to cook and preserve additional food. This abundance allowed humanity to devote more time to developing better equipment like kilns and plows. As you can see, one single spark set off an upward cycle of innovation that continues to this day.



3. Language enabled humans to organize actions and establish permanent cultures.


Chimpanzees excel in climbing, grooming one another, and catching termites with sticks. But if you attempt conversing with one, you'll see they could be better conversationalists. So, why are we so much more talkative than our nearest ape relatives?


It is partly due to the FOXP2 gene. This small genetic code regulates hundreds of physical and cognitive characteristics related to speaking. Our version of FOXP2 is nearly identical to that of chimps, but the few variances offer us a significant advantage when learning and using language.


Most chimpanzees can be taught a few words and signs. However, the average person can recognize approximately 42,000 words by age twenty. This outstanding communication ability has significantly impacted our history and success.


The essential takeaway is that language enables humans to organize activities and create permanent cultures.


Modern beings are born with the intrinsic ability to master language. This talent is based on mental and physical attributes developed over thousands of generations. Our bipedal position, for example, allows us to breathe more freely, while our low and flexible larynx enables us to shape that air into hundreds of sounds. Our brains have also adapted, developing critical linguistic skills such as pattern recognition and abstract reasoning.


Our species' language proficiency gives it a significant advantage over other animals. Using speech and gestures, we can communicate complicated thoughts and coordinate tasks such as hunting, trading, and shelter construction. And, thanks to the introduction of writing some 5,000 years ago, we can accomplish even more. This astonishing breakthrough enabled humans to store and transfer information with high fidelity over long distances and across generations. 


Writing allows you to read the 4,000-year-old epic of Gilgamesh like an ancient Babylonian would. Furthermore, you will likely enjoy it. That's because, like language, people have formed a strong bond with storytelling and the narratives it conveys. Across cultures, humans use stories to entertain one another, foster empathy, establish shared ideals, and make sense of the chaotic world around us.


Storytelling is so strong that it may synchronize the brains of both the speaker and the listener. Brain scans reveal that when people visualize the activities or sensations in a novel, their brains engage as if it were all true. This is why information presented as a story is 22 times more memorable than a list of facts. With such an intimate effect, it's no surprise that some of our most ancient cultural traditions are myths and legends passed down through generations.



4. Beauty and aesthetics give humans purpose and motivation.


Imagine someone wearing a piece of jewelry. What are you seeing? Perhaps it's a queen wearing an extravagant crown and scepter. Maybe it's a young woman wearing a sparkling diamond engagement ring. Or it might be a preacher holding a simple gold cross. 


In all of these examples, the accessories serve a purpose beyond decoration. They tell the story of who each person is, their values, and where they fit in society. The materials used in each decoration are deeply rooted in humanity's travel, trade, and conquest history.


Our aesthetic expressions are far more than passing trends or superficial fashions. Our need to create and acquire beauty is a driving force in how we act as humans. 


The main idea here is that beauty and aesthetics give mankind meaning and inspiration.


Our species is hardwired to value beauty. Humans have sought the most healthy and fertile mates for millennia by looking for health-related visual clues like face symmetry and clear complexions. We virtually universally find these features visually appealing. However, our perception of beauty is primarily subjective and culturally dependent. Furthermore, aesthetics are used for various objectives other than mate selection.


Humans from various cultures employ artificial ornamentation such as dress, jewelry, makeup, and body art to symbolically arrange communities. For example, the Turkana women of Kenya wear colored necklaces to indicate their status: yellow is for unmarried women, and white is for widows. In feudal Japan, only royals could wear silk, while others sought style through brilliant and complex tattoos.


Our desire for beauty has influenced the development of entire civilizations. Europe's quest for valuable metals and exotic spices sparked the first maritime journeys, which led to the growth of the slave trade and the colonization of the Americas. Previously, there was the Silk Road. This vast network of trade channels transported countless commodities, ideas, and diseases throughout Europe and Asia. However, it derives its name from the sumptuous and visually appealing fabric that became its most valuable commercial commodity.


But it does not end there. Our appreciation for beauty may be rooted in architectural and urban design innovations. After all, some of our first permanent constructions are about artistic expression rather than protection. Just consider Göbekli-Tepe in southeastern Turkey. Over 12,000 years ago, nomadic herdsmen created this megalithic temple complex. They also adorned it elaborately. That shows that even before agriculture, humans collaborated to build beautiful settings. The value of aesthetics cannot be emphasized.



5. Our grasp of time allows us to interact with the world sensibly.


Let's travel back 1.5 million years. In Africa, one of our ancestors cuts an antelope carcass with a rudimentary stone axe. She carves meat from the bone and eats her fill. Then she does something remarkable: when she leaves the supper, she carries her axe to use later.


In this case, the most incredible invention isn't the stone in her palm. It's something more intangible that exists in her head. It's the very definition of "later." While most primates would abandon the instrument after one use, this early human envisions a future in which the tool will be helpful again. She understands time.


Thinking in terms of time is a simple concept nowadays. However, it is an incredible cognitive leap that changed the fate of our entire species.


The main lesson here is that our concept of time allows us to interact with the world sensibly.


Like all other species, human bodies are inextricably linked to time. Our circadian rhythms allow us to wake and sleep in time with light, while hormones control other biological rhythms such as heart rate, hunger, and menstrual cycles. However, the conscious experience of time, i.e., the ability to remember previous events and foresee future developments, is unique to humans.


The ability to conceptualize time is one of our oldest and most significant technologies. Understanding past and present connections enabled our forefathers to grasp critical cause-and-effect interactions, such as the link between mating and delivery. Understanding the cyclical pattern of the seasons also helped us predict the optimal times to sow seeds and harvest crops, two abilities that were critical in the development of agriculture. 


The amount of work we've used to measure time demonstrates its importance. As history reveals, mankind has always strived to create more accurate timepieces. As early as 38,000 years ago, mankind etched ivory tablets with precise lunar cycle accounts. Later, the Romans refined sundials, which divided days into hours. By the fourteenth century, European towns had gigantic mechanical clocks that kept everyone on the same schedule.


Objectively quantifying time altered every aspect of human life. Accurate clocks made it easier for ships to traverse the seas, paved the way for Enlightenment physics experiments, and allowed industrialists to organize workers hourly. In other words, time is a tool that has guided both our intellectual pursuits and our material output.
